20130144384 | SOFT TISSUE GRAFT FIXATION - A surgical method for anterior cruciate ligament reconstruction includes creating a bone tunnel in a head of a femur of a patient. A connective tissue is inserted into the bone tunnel. A shape memory polymer plug is inserted into the bone tunnel. The plug has a first configuration for insertion and a second configuration for affixation that has a radially expanded dimension that presses the connective tissue against a side wall of the bone tunnel to affix the connective tissue in the bone tunnel. The plug changes from the first configuration to the second configuration in response to an activation temperature equal to or greater than a temperature of the femur. | 06-06-2013 |
20140121295 | SHAPE MEMORY POLYMER - A polymer is composed of a linear chain acrylate and a multi-functional acrylate cross-linker. The polymerized composition exhibits a transition at a temperature between about 34° C. and about 50° C. The polymerized composition exhibits shape memory effects. In one embodiment, the linear chain is tert-butyl acrylate and the crosslinker is polyethylene glycol dimethacrylate. The resultant shape memory polymers may be used in medical devices to provide devices with different shapes for pre and post implantation. | 05-01-2014 |

20080218102 | Programmable radio frequency waveform generatior for a synchrocyclotron - A synchrocyclotron comprises a resonant circuit that includes electrodes having a gap therebetween across the magnetic field. An oscillating voltage input, having a variable amplitude and frequency determined by a programmable digital waveform generator generates an oscillating electric field across the gap. The synchrocyclotron can include a variable capacitor in circuit with the electrodes to vary the resonant frequency. The synchrocyclotron can further include an injection electrode and an extraction electrode having voltages controlled by the programmable digital waveform generator. The synchrocyclotron can further include a beam monitor. The synchrocyclotron can detect resonant conditions in the resonant circuit by measuring the voltage and or current in the resonant circuit, driven by the input voltage, and adjust the capacitance of the variable capacitor or the frequency of the input voltage to maintain the resonant conditions. The programmable waveform generator can adjust at least one of the oscillating voltage input, the voltage on the injection electrode and the voltage on the extraction electrode according to beam intensity and in response to changes in resonant conditions. | 09-11-2008 |

20100230617 | CHARGED PARTICLE RADIATION THERAPY - Among other things, an accelerator is mounted on a gantry to enable the accelerator to move through a range of positions around a patient on a patient support. The accelerator is configured to produce a proton or ion beam having an energy level sufficient to reach any arbitrary target in the patient from positions within the range. The proton or ion beam passes essentially directly from the accelerator to the patient. In some examples, the synchrocyclotron has a superconducting electromagnetic structure that generates a field strength of at least 6 Tesla, produces a beam of particles having an energy level of at least 150 MeV, has a volume no larger than 4.5 cubic meters, and has a weight less than 30 Tons. | 09-16-2010 |
20100308235 | Programmable Particle Scatterer for Radiation Therapy Beam Formation - Interposing a programmable path length of one or more materials into a particle beam modulates scattering angle and beam range in a predetermined manner to create a predetermined spread out Bragg peak at a predetermined range. Materials can be “low Z” and “high Z” materials that include fluids. A charged particle beam scatterer/range modulator can comprise a fluid reservoir having opposing walls in a particle beam path and a drive to adjust the distance between the walls of the fluid reservoir under control by a programmable controller. A “high Z” and, independently, a “low Z” reservoir, arranged in series, can be used. When used for radiation treatment, the beam can be monitored by measuring beam intensity, and the programmable controller can adjust the distance between the opposing walls of the “high Z” reservoir and, independently, the distance between the opposing walls of the “low Z” reservoir according to a predetermined relationship to integral beam intensity. Beam scattering and modulation can be done continuously and dynamically during a treatment in order to deposit dose in a target volume in a predetermined three dimensional distribution. | 12-09-2010 |
